Course Details
• Unit 1: Introduction to Alef Bet - Overview of the Hebrew alphabet, including the history and significance of Alef Bet.
• Unit 2: The Hebrew Consonants - In-depth exploration of the Hebrew consonants, including their names, pronunciation, and written forms.
• Unit 3: The Hebrew Vowels - Understanding of the Hebrew vowel system, including the different types of vowel signs and their pronunciation.
• Unit 4: Reading Hebrew - Practice in reading Hebrew text, starting with individual letters and gradually progressing to words and sentences.
• Unit 5: Writing Hebrew - Instruction in writing Hebrew, including the correct stroke order and formation of letters.
• Unit 6: Pronunciation and Fluency - Techniques for improving pronunciation and fluency in Hebrew, including listening exercises and speaking practice.
• Unit 7: Hebrew Grammar - Overview of Hebrew grammar, including the basic rules of word formation and sentence structure.
• Unit 8: Hebrew Vocabulary - Introduction to common Hebrew words and phrases, including their pronunciation, spelling, and meaning.
• Unit 9: Cultural Context - Understanding of the cultural context of Hebrew, including its use in Jewish religious practices and everyday life.
• Unit 10: Assessment and Evaluation - Final assessment of the student's mastery of Alef Bet, including both written and oral evaluations.
